Transaction eb886ffb434a0a2deb5a4ce22ea4396196532f59f562beb19aa0f82483321e50
1 Input
1 Output
-
eb886ffb434a0a2deb5a4ce22ea4396196532f59f562beb19aa0f82483321e50:0
- value
- 23910
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c34b51d492ea306a1a1689263935410b12b1a21 OP_EQUAL
- address
- 3EUMfaagWbTcpkASqw6sk928nKuk8b15Lz